Subject: Slimforge cut-over complete

Team — the migration to Slimforge-built container images finished last night. All services now pull the slimmed base, cutting average image size by 61% and cold-start pull time roughly in half. Two services needed shell utilities restored via an overlay layer; both are documented. For the sync, please review the build settings we standardized on, shown here.

settings of fafog-haduf:
ZORIX_PIN=4648
ZORIX_METRICS_HOST=metrics.zorix.paliqsys.corp
ZORIX_LOG_LEVEL=info
ZORIX_TENANT=druix

Subject: Handover — relevance tuning, week 42

Hey Marisol, passing the pager. Quick notes on the Findrell relevance work: the synonym expansion experiment is still at 10% traffic; don't ramp it until the click-model retrain finishes. Plugin authors keep asking why boost weights shifted — point them to the tuning changelog, not the raw configs. One flaky canary on the ranker shadow pool; I silenced it till Monday. Anything weird with scoring plugins, forward it to the relevance crew at the address below.

escalation mailbox, bafog-fafog: ulador@paliqlabs.internal

Release checklist — item 7: health checks behind the Kestrelgate load balancer. Before promoting, confirm the new /ready endpoint returns 200 only after the cache warmer finishes; the old endpoint lied during warmup and the balancer routed traffic into cold nodes, which caused the Brindle launch wobble. Verify drain timeout is set above the warmer's worst-case duration, and that both availability zones report healthy independently. Reviewer should sign off only after comparing the deployed artifact against the reference noted below.

trace token, yafog-bafop: htk31_90e4e3962168bb1bf8de5dfe86ea527

## Account Recovery — Trailnote Offline Mode

When a surveyor's Trailnote app has been offline for 30+ days, their local credentials expire and sync refuses to resume. Don't make them wipe the device — all their unsynced field data lives there! Instead, open the support console, pick "Offline Reinstate," and enter their handle. The console will ask for the support team's shared recovery passphrase before issuing a reinstatement token. Use the one below.

unlock words, bagaf-fajeg: zorael-kelax-fraath-quenix-eliok-sileth-aldmir-wenir-druiel